Boron Nitride Plates/Trays [MH-BNC995T - BoronNitride]
Product Features
Introducing our high-performance Boron Nitride (BN) Products, designed for high-temperature applications and exceptional durability:
- High Purity and Density: Featuring >99.5% BN purity and a density of 1.95±0.05 g/cm³, ensuring superior performance in extreme conditions.
- Exceptional Thermal Properties: With a maximum operating temperature of 850°C in air and >2000°C in inert atmospheres, the material is perfect for high-temperature applications.
- Superior Mechanical Strength: The flexural strength of 22 MPa and hardness of 4 kg/mm² ensure that these products maintain structural integrity under stress.
- No Binder Additives: Our process excludes the use of binders, ensuring the stability and purity of the final product.
Applications
Boron Nitride products are ideal for:
- High-Purity Crucibles: Suitable for molten metal handling in extreme temperature environments.
- Crucible and Bearing Plates: Designed for the sintering of nitride phosphors, silicon nitride, aluminum nitride, and other ceramics and powders.
- High-Temperature Furnace Components: Including electrode insulation parts and protective tubes for use in extreme thermal conditions.
- Boron Nitride Insulation: Used in polysilicon ingot furnaces for insulation assemblies.
Technical Highlights
- Cold Isostatic Pressing and Hot Pressing Sintering: Utilizes advanced two-way pressure sintering technology to create highly dense and durable materials.
- Low Thermal Expansion: Coefficient of thermal expansion is controlled between -1 to 1.2 (10⁻⁶/K), ensuring dimensional stability in temperature variations.
- High Thermal Conductivity: With thermal conductivity ranging from 50-70 W/mK, these products efficiently manage heat, ensuring consistent performance in high-temperature environments.
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| BN Purity (%) | >99.5 |
| Other Components | No |
| Density (g/cm³) | 1.95±0.05 |
| Hardness (kg/mm²) | 4 |
| Porosity (%) | <15 |
| Flexural Strength (MPa) | 22 |
| Coefficient of Thermal Expansion (10⁻⁶/K) | -1~1.2 |
| Thermal Conductivity (W/mK) | 50-70 |
| Max. Operating Temperature in Air (°C) | 850°C |
| Max. Operating Temperature in Inert Atmosphere (°C) | >2000°C |
| Room Temperature Resistivity (Ω•cm) | 10¹⁴ |
